What Are Hazardous Location Lights?

Hazardous location lights are specially designed for environments where dangerous substances might be present. These fixtures are built to withstand extreme conditions and to minimize the risk of ignition. They are classified according to various standards, including ANSI and IECEx, ensuring that they meet safety regulations for such environments.

Factors to Consider When Choosing Hazardous Location Lighting

When deciding on the best hazardous location lights for your needs, consider a few key factors:

  • Certification: Ensure that the lights are certified for the specific hazardous environment you’re working in. Look for ratings such as Class I, Division 1, etc.
  • Energy Efficiency: LED fixtures often provide significant savings over time, making them an attractive option.
  • Durability: Look for materials that can withstand harsh chemicals and extreme weather conditions.
  • Versatility: Choose lights that can be used in multiple applications to maximize your investment.
